THIS WEEK’S ‘PREP BALLPLAYER’ FINALISTS

Garrett Matheny, Sr., INF, Calvert Hall
Matheny was a major contributor in the Cardinals’ three wins this past week. The senior recorded eight hits – five singles, a double, a triple and a home run – and had seven RBIs. He also scored five runs and stole four bases – one being a straight steal of home.

Kody Milton, Jr., RHP/INF, Severna Park
Four games weren’t an issue for Milton and the Falcons. The junior belted two, two-run homers to open the week against Old Mill in an 8-6 win and added another the next day against Northeast. He recorded a combined six RBIs and scored three runs in those three at-bats. On Wednesday, the right-hander pitched a scoreless seventh and scored a run against Chesapeake to clinch the 3-2 victory. Milton’s week ended Thursday against North County, when he knocked in a run in an 8-5 win.

Jarrett Schneider, Sr., RHP/INF, Harford Tech
Schneider threw a gem Tuesday against Joppatowne. The senior struck out seven and allowed two hits in five shutout innings. In that game, he recorded a base hit, a stolen base and two RBIs. The right-hander then registered three hits – one being a double – three RBIs and a run scored in a 10-8 win over Perryville the next day. Schneider capped off the week with two hits, one RBI and a run against Bo Manor on Thursday.
